Subject: Halverton franchise agreement — where we stand

Hi all,

Quick update for department heads: the franchise agreement with Brindlewick Foods is basically done. Legal signed off yesterday, and the Halverton group wants to launch three pilot outlets this spring. Royalties and territory terms came in better than expected. Keep this within your teams for now, and note the confidential line below.

internal memo for kawip-hadug: Headcount on the Wenwyn team goes from 7 to 140 by the end of January. Gross margin on Wenwyn came in at 20 percent against a plan of 15 percent.

Welcome to the Farebend pricing crew! This quarter we're running the Tiered Tuesday experiment, which tweaks ticket prices for off-peak showings at Lanternvale venues. As release manager, you'll gate the experiment flags per cohort — nothing ships without your sign-off, so don't let anyone rush you. Rollouts happen Wednesdays, rollbacks anytime. Marta on the growth side owns the metrics dashboard; ping her before widening a cohort. The full experiment plan, cohort splits, and rollback steps live on the internal page below.

operations page: https://gitlab.qirvanlabs.corp/pages/view/dash/35f614e5fc69

Service accounts for the Stormfan fan-out pipeline are managed per-environment and scoped to publish-only on the alert topics. As a contractor, you should never reuse a production account in staging; each environment issues its own credential with a 90-day lifetime. To run the fan-out worker locally against the sandbox broker, authenticate using the key below.

gateway credential: kto23_LX9A4ys6i4nzHtpOLNLodKK